Product Introduction

Overview

The SN74HC574NSR, produced by Texas Instruments, is an octal edge-triggered D-type flip-flop with 3-state outputs. This component is designed for bus driving and is particularly suitable for implementing buffer registers, I/O ports, bidirectional bus drivers, and working registers. The flip-flops enter data on the low-to-high transition of the clock (CLK) input, and a buffered output-enable (OE) input allows the outputs to be placed in either a normal logic state or a high-impedance state.

Key Features

  • Wide operating voltage range of 2 V to 6 V.
  • High-current 3-state noninverting outputs that can drive bus lines directly or up to 15 LSTTL loads.
  • Low power consumption, with a maximum supply current (ICC) of 80 µA at 6 V.
  • Typical propagation delay of 22 ns at 5 V.
  • Output drive capability of ±6 mA at 5 V.
  • Low input current of 1 µA maximum.
  • Bus-structured pinout.
  • Output-enable (OE) input to place outputs in high-impedance state.

Applications

The SN74HC574NSR is particularly suitable for various applications, including:

  • Implementing buffer registers and working registers.
  • Creating I/O ports and bidirectional bus drivers.
  • Bus driving in digital systems where high-impedance states are necessary.
